== Function ==
 +
[https://www.uniprot.org/uniprot/B0V9T6_ACIBY B0V9T6_ACIBY] [https://www.uniprot.org/uniprot/B0VP98_ACIBS B0VP98_ACIBS] Topoisomerase IV is essential for chromosome segregation. It relaxes supercoiled DNA. Performs the decatenation events required during the replication of a circular DNA molecule.[HAMAP-Rule:MF_00936]
